So I tried it out, and turned out to be very very surprised.

This was my first run out, haven't sailed in fresh water for ages and was pretty awesome. So I was alone and it felt a bit weird and freaky all so quite etc.

When I first got there the wind was a bit... bitchy is about the best way to put it. As if it was purposefully teasing you in an unpredictable way. After a few runs it got strong and super consistent... was on my 5.7 and fully powered almost all the time, got a bit tired and left early. Here is a clip of my first run when the wind was lighter. It turned out to be an epic day.

Maybe I was lucky dno...

Logan Inlet...

When I first got there I was at the first/second entrance on the bottom west side of the dam, by the dam wall.. A guy said I shouldn't be there and said I should go over further up to logan Inlet
